Here are some things to keep in mind while designing your home office:
Plan a Conducive Setup
A comfortable setup for your home office is required to optimize your productivity. Following suitable conditions will make it a perfect home office:
- Appropriate ventilation
- Installation of UV in the HVAC system to improve indoor air quality
- Ergonomic chair and keyboard
- Some indoor plants to freshen the air
- Proper lighting for virtual meetings with customers or colleagues
- An adaptive Wi-Fi
Necessary Tools
Youโll also need a blend of various online tools and SaaS solutions to work remotely and enable a contactless experience with your clients. Using online solutions helps you maintain a safe distance from your customers while fulfilling your work obligations. Some of these tools are:
- Instant communication tools such as Cliq, Microsoft Teams or Slack
- Video calling platforms like Zoom, Skype, and Google Chat
- Project management tools like Workfront, ProofHub, com, and Trello
- Digital assistant tools like a Siri-enabled Apple product, Amazon Echo, or Google Assistant to manage your work
- Tools like officevibe, JotForm, and Hubstaff for monitoring the work
- Online payment software like Scoro or Zoho for invoicing and estimates
- Online business formation services like ZenBusiness to quickly file for an LLC.

Increase the Value of Your Property
The COVID-19 pandemic has completely changed the work locations of companies, and the ever-increasing need for people to work from home has had a direct impact on the property market. Now people prefer to buy properties with fully functional home offices. Home office space can get you more value per square foot if you intend to sell your property in the future. Some home offices can get as much value as another bedroom commensurate with the location and design of the space, and fetch more bucks compared with the same size property without a home office.
If you wish to sell your home with a dedicated home office, be sure to spotlight it in the description of your property. You should save pictures of your property before and after adding a home office and maintain a detailed record of all additions and renovations to increase its appraisal value in the market.
